EPT Tallinn : Kevin Stani won the Estonian stage

It took eight hours of play for the 8 finalists in the final table of the European Poker Tour Tallinn to designate the champion of the main event, who were Kevin Stani, a player in his first victory. This young 27 years old Norwegian is the first to receive the title of champion of the 13 stages of this 7th edition of the EPT with a gain of € 400,000 after his final head's up with the 22 years old Russian Konstantin Bilyauer. Before the coronation, Kevin Stani already achieved very promising results in major poker events like his 127th place finish at the last World Championships of the World Series of Poker 2010 in Las Vegas.



The three contenders for the Estonian tournament of € 4.000 + € 250 Konstantin Bilyauer with 2.498 million chips, Kevin Stani with 2.586 million and 3.72 million for Arnaud Mattern who already owned 75% of the chips at the beginning of the final competition were the best placed to take the title. But after 480 minutes, cards have chosen their camp after eliminating in turn the French, former title holder of the EPT Prague in 2007 and the very young Russian who is in his second participation in live poker tournament. Here is the ranking of EPT Tallinn 2010: Kevin Stani in the first place winning € 400,000, runner up Konstantin Bilyauer with € 250,000, € 160,000 for Arnaud Mattern 3rd, 4th Dmitry Vitkind (€ 120,000), Jaatinen Mikko 5th (€ 80,000), 6th Steven van Zadelhoff (€ 63,000), Nicolo Calia 7th and 8th Elnajjar Bassam who repectively go back home with € 47,000 and € 32,000. The next stage of the European poker tour will be held in Vilamoura, Portugal from August 27th to September 2nd, 2010.
